Health officials in Minnesota have confirmed nine cases of measles in the state, all in children who have not been vaccinated. There have also been recent cases of measles in Nebraska, Michigan and Texas. Experts say it could be a bad year for measles globally.

Here & Now's Meghna Chakrabarti speaks with Patsy Stinchfield (@InfectiousPS), senior director of infection prevention and control at Children's Hospitals and Clinics of Minnesota.

This segment aired on April 18, 2017.
